Vehicles with third-row seating primarily include SUVs and minivans, designed for family use or those requiring ample passenger space. Popular SUVs with this feature encompass the Ford Explorer, Toyota Highlander, Honda Pilot, Chevrolet Tahoe, and the Kia Sorento, among others. Minivans like the Honda Odyssey, Chrysler Pacifica, and Toyota Sienna also offer third-row seating, focusing on comfort and accessibility. These vehicles vary in size, fuel efficiency, and price, catering to a wide range of preferences and needs. When choosing a vehicle with third-row seating, consider factors such as the ease of access to the third row, cargo space when the third row is in use, and overall vehicle performance.

Revving the engine can indeed help charge the car battery quicker, but it's not the most efficient or recommended method. When you rev the engine, the alternator works faster due to the increased engine speed, generating more electricity which in turn charges the battery. Normally, the alternator charges the battery when the vehicle is running, regardless of engine speed, but the process is slower at idle or at low speeds. However, frequently revving the engine specifically to charge the battery can lead to unnecessary wear on the engine and increased fuel consumption. It's a method best used sparingly, in situations where you might need a quick charge to start the car, rather than as a regular battery maintenance strategy. For ensuring your battery remains charged and healthy, regular driving and proper maintenance are more effective and safer methods.
